1. Have you ever ridden on a balloon? Many tourist spots offer balloon rides in
order for people to see the beauty of a place from above. A balloon contains a
noble gas called helium(氦). Formerly, balloons contained hydrogen but hydrogen
is very flammable and dangerous when uncontrolled. Therefore, people shifted to
helium, which is safer. Helium is safe because it has the properties of the
noble gases. 2. People once believed that noble gases couldn't
chemically react at all. For this reason, they were called inert gases(惰性气体).
They were also listed under Group 0 in the old periodic table because scientists
believed that the gases have zero valence (价) electrons in their outer shell.
This was later proven to be untrue when some noble gas compounds were
discovered. 3. The gases are elements, which share similar
properties. These properties include being monoatomic, colorless, odorless,
being able to conduct electricity, and having low chemical reactivity. Noble
gases include Helium, Neon, Argon, Krypton, Xenon and Radon. These are all found
in Group 18, in the rightmost column of the periodic table. If you look at the
periodic table, you will notice that these elements are the only ones, which do
not have a charge. Helium has the lowest molecular (分子的) weight while Radon is
the heaviest. 4. Remember that chemical reactions occur because
atoms have valence electrons, which are electrons in their outer shell. When the
outer shell is "unfilled" or the required number of electrons is not yet
complete, the atom is more reactive. Noble gases have a full outer shell,
meaning that they have complete electrons in their outer shell. This complete
number varies. For instance, the outer shell of Helium has 2 valence electrons
while the outer shell of Xenon has 8 electrons. Nowadays, there remains to be a
few noble gases because of the low chemical reactivity of these said
gases. 5. Because of their properties, noble gases have many
important applications. They are widely used in medicine and industries. For
instance, liquid Helium is used for superconducting magnets(磁体). These magnets
are very important in physics and medicine. When a doctor suspects that a
person's brain has been damaged, he might request for Magnetic Resonance
Imaging(MRI). MRI allows the doctor to "see" the brain, without operating on the
patient.
